Frequently Asked Questions About Pest Control in Willisburg

Get answers to common questions about pest control services in Willisburg, Kentucky.

1What are the most common pest problems for homeowners in Willisburg, and when should I be most vigilant?

In Willisburg, the humid subtropical climate and mix of rural and residential areas lead to common issues with ants (especially odorous house ants and carpenter ants), spiders, rodents like mice and voles, and occasional termite activity. Seasonal vigilance is key: spring and summer see spikes in ants and spiders, fall drives rodents indoors seeking warmth, and termite swarms typically occur in our region from March to May. Regular inspections during these periods can prevent major infestations.

2How much should I expect to pay for routine pest control services in the Willisburg area?

For a standard quarterly exterior perimeter treatment for common insects, Willisburg homeowners can typically expect to pay between $100-$150 per service visit, with an initial inspection often being free. More comprehensive plans that include interior treatments or specialized services for pests like termites or rodents will cost more. Pricing is generally in line with regional Kentucky averages but can vary based on your home's square footage and the severity of the issue.

3Are there any local Kentucky or Willisburg regulations I should know about when hiring a pest control company?

Yes. Any company applying pesticides in Kentucky must be licensed by the Kentucky Department of Agriculture (KDA). Always verify that a provider holds a current KDA license, which ensures they are trained in safe, effective application methods and state regulations. Reputable local companies in Washington County will also provide you with a detailed service report and information about any products used, as required by state law.

5Is preventative pest control necessary in Willisburg, or should I just treat problems as they appear?

Given Kentucky's seasonal shifts and the prevalence of wood-destroying organisms like termites and carpenter ants, a preventative plan is highly recommended. Reactive treatment often means an infestation is already established, which is more costly and damaging. A scheduled preventative program creates a consistent barrier, addresses seasonal surges proactively, and often includes termite monitoring, which is crucial for protecting your home's structure in our climate.
